Restoration and refurbishment of the Racetrack of the Zarzuela Hippodrome in Madrid. Phase I

The Zarzuela Hippodrome racecourse is an exceptional works of Spanish architecture from the first third of the 20th century, and its structure of  grandstands and canopies was one of the world’s greatest achievements of the century. In 2009 the Ministry of Culture declared the Recinto de Carreras a Cultural Interest Asset in the Monument category.

In 2004, Junquera Arquitectos won the tender for the Restoration and Refurbishment of the Hipódromo de la Zarzuela Racecourse, organised by the company Hipódromo de la Zarzuela S.A. Work began in 2008 with the restoration of the grandstand canopies, which had deteriorated over time and had been damaged by water and building work carried out in earlier stages. At the same time as the canopies were being restored, a construction survey was made of the site. This was research work to discover and analyse the original values and construction systems, which had been distorted and lost through extensions and modifications made to the site. This revealed significant structural damage which required consolidating and repairing the structure. Once the structural repairs had been made, the restoration and refurbishment of the architectural complex began, with the aim of recovering the essential values of the 1934 project by Arniches, Domínguez and Torroja:

- Implementation of the built area: adaptation to the land and integration into the surroundings.

- Functional organisation: uses and traffic.

- Unity and scale of the ensemble: the restoration project was responsible for the beauty of the future racecourse to enhance its original values by recovering those it had lost. To do this, it was proposed:

- Removing attachments to the historic buildings that had been distorted.

- Restore the racecourse's emblematic grandstands for watching the races.

- Adapting the topography and separating horse and public traffic on two levels as per the 1934 project: the public enters the site through the south and north courtyards, which are connected by the paddock gallery. All the horse's movements on a lower level are visible from this level without interfering. The courtyards give onto the terraces between the grandstands, with views of the track and the city.

- The saddle rooms stay in their original position, with the racing, jockeys, veterinary, etc. services around them in a new building dug into the ground and open to gardens that provide privacy, lighting and natural ventilation. With independent entrances and direct access to the paddock and the central grandstand without contact with the public.

- Provide for the possible extension of an underground Convention Centre in the north courtyard without affecting the views of the historic buildings and the landscape. The proposal is to recover the Zarzuela Hippodrome for the city with optimal facilities for racing and equestrian sport, balancing the use and enjoyment of the monument.
